    My family went here for dinner our first night in the Netherlands. I was very glad to be able to…read moreget in as a walk-in, but it was pretty quiet early on a rainy Monday evening. I think we were the first to arrive for dinner around five. We quickly settled on the option for a "carte blanche" chef's choice (four courses plus extras for 50 Euro). That sort of dinner is my post-night-flight ideal: Something exciting to keep everyone up late enough to ward off jet-lag, gladly entrusting many of the decisions to someone more awake. They suggested it would be reasonable to split that for two between our family of three, given the kid's smaller appetite, that was definitely the correct call. The meal was phenomenal, every dish was a beautiful blending of textures and flavors. They cleverly paired the dishes for each course. Everything looked perfect, starting with the food, but the whole dining area was a lovely space, including the view into the open kitchen. Even the flower arrangements around the dining room were strikingly beautiful. The staff were all very friendly and attentive. I enjoyed a beer from Utrecht's own Brouwerij Eleven to accompany my meal. Koenraad's selection of beer is smaller than their extensive wine list, but has a reasonable amount of variety. I didn't look at the wine list in detail, but the other parties present seemed pleased with their selections.

    I love that there is a tea shop near my place. I love even more the passion these two have for tea…read more They know it all! And their teas are premium and you can taste it. First of all, when walking in you are warmly greeted. I was waiting for a friend and so the women showed me the different seating areas to choose from. I love the variety! My favorite is the couch... It could be my living room... Filled with tea :) I mentioned the type of tea I typically enjoy and I was taking through the varieties they had that I might like. There's a wall of tea to explore! We got very educated on how it's premium and the different types. It's not just tea though... They have bites! Either low or no sugar treats that are delicious. I got the jam cookie. So perfect! The tea is the main event though, right? And it was so good. Mine had a taste of honey while my friend's was stronger. Just mention what you like and they will find something right for you. They can also add more water to the pot so you can get sometimes 3-5 pots from the one set of leaves! Also, you are served which I find lovely. I can't wait to go back and take my husband. It was so nice to escape the cold, hang out with a friend in a cosy shop, and have amazing tea.

    Ever heard of matcha? Well, it's ground powder of specially grown and processed green tea. Hong…read moreTong Wu and his sister Yiemie, the owners of Tea's Delight, know how to treat this ingredient right. They put it in their ice cream, cookies and pancake, one topped with a slice of apple - fresh, slightly sour -and perfectly green cream. Eating this pancake may be a (tiny) sin, but it make's you feel super zen in return. Not only since it's delicious, but also because of the well balanced nature of this place. On the lower ground floor, you'll find the dark yin space, including light teaware made of glass and porcelain. Upstairs you'll find the lighter yang space with dark tea pots on the floor. Add to all this the soft voices of the sweet owners who patiently tell you all about the origins of their loose tea leaves and you'll float to another world. To China where most of their tea comes from. Or to Taiwan where their fabulous Oriental Beauty Oolong Tea is born.
